• Maciej Żenczykowski's avatar
    iproute2: tc/m_pedit.c - remove dead code · 0bbca042
    Maciej Żenczykowski authored
    The initializers are simply not needed.
    
    These if-blocks are outright dead code, because '0 > unsigned' is always
    false, so only else clause triggers and regardless of which clause triggers
    it only updates 'ind' which is later unconditionally written to before
    being used anyway.
    
    Otherwise we get errors from clang:
    
      m_pedit.c:166:8: error: comparison of 0 > unsigned expression is always false [-Werror,-Wtautological-compare]
        if (0 > tkey->off) {
            ~ ^ ~~~~~~~~~
      m_pedit.c:209:8: error: comparison of 0 > unsigned expression is always false [-Werror,-Wtautological-compare]
        if (0 > tkey->off) {
            ~ ^ ~~~~~~~~~
      2 errors generated.
    
    Change-Id: I3c9e9092915088fc56f992e5df736851541a4458
    0bbca042
m_pedit.c 11.5 KB